This is a listing of the readings for ENSC 696 when I last taught it, in Fall 2017.
The course takes up a variety of topics: chemical exposures, natural resources land management, administrative law, risk assessment, emergency planning, chronic health effects, studies of this kind in Calcasieu Parish. I will not just repeat this lineup, but this gives you and idea of what the course is like. I will certainly add some natural resource GIS applications that I have been using.
Students are required to give a presentation to the class.
